After the revolution of 1357 and from the beginning of the formation of the government of the Islamic Republic, a fierce conflict began between the traditional movement and the modern movement for the type of encounter with art, including music. ordered to ban the broadcasting of music on radio and television. In a frank comment, he considered music to be similar to opium and said, “Listening to music makes people stupid and makes their brains empty and inactive.”
